Shown is a 1787MoFM escudo, of a type struck in Mexico 1772-1788. The escudos of Charles III come in three types: KM 116, struck 1760-61, KM 117, struck 1762-71 and KM 118, struck 1772-88. KM 118 is further divided into three subtypes; KM 118.1, with inverted assayers' initials, struck 1772-73 only; KM 118.2, struck 1773-84; and KM 118.2a (this type), struck 1785-88 with fineness reduced to 875 thousandths.
Recorded mintage: unknown.
Specification: 3.38 g, 0.875 fine gold, .095 troy oz AGW.
Catalog reference: Cayón-12361, KM 118.2a.
